Last July Risa delivered six gorgeous pups into the world. The sire is also a champion, from Wincroft Kennels.
We called the pups Katsuro (who we still have), Kemi (the single female), Icee, (now named Bennie in his new forever home) Ryui (now called Murphy), Deak (now named Osito) and Chi (now named Bailey).
Risa was a 'no nonsense mom' who taught her pups to play, to go downstairs by gently nudging them down one step at a time and much more. Wasabi was the tease in the house and would often be found getting the pups barking and going. Risa didn't seem to mind.
For the first three weeks or so they mainly ate and slept, opened their eyes, opened their ears, stood, moved around, started walking mostly over each other, standing on their back legs, jumping, wrestling, playing. By the fourth week every day brought a new and wonderful revelation. Each morning there was something new. It was a rare pleasure and priviledge to watch them grow.
